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Dignowity Hill Apartments

What is a cheap apartment in Dignowity Hill?

A cheap apartment is any apartment up to the 30% percentile of cost for the area, which in Dignowity Hill is under $793.

What is the price of a cheap apartment in Dignowity Hill?

The cheapest apartment in Dignowity Hill is 127 Sandmeyer St which is listed at $750, while the average apartment in Dignowity Hill costs $3,962.

What types of apartments are the cheapest in Dignowity Hill?

Student, low-income, and by-the-bed apartments are typically the cheapest rentals in most cities, though they require qualifying criteria to rent. There are 1,796 regular apartments in Dignowity Hill that we think qualify as ‘cheap apartments’ that do not have special requirements to apply to rent.

How do the prices of cheap apartments compare to the average apartment in Dignowity Hill?

Cheap apartments in Dignowity Hill have an average cost of $460 which is $3,502 cheaper than the average rent for all rentals in Dignowity Hill.
